Monday, April 8, 2013

Kawaii, Please.

I think Beast may have taken that Magical Girl Beast schtick a bit too far.

Here's the crew of Kamen Rider Wizard goofing off and taking weird photos while waiting for it to stop raining so they can film an action scene.

